    Accounts Receivable Manager

    K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Review of the Credit Management process to drive attainment of overall target DSO
    • Review and advise on current level of Risk Management & exposure and champion strategies to minimize the credit risk
    • Advise on quality management of the debtor asset
    • Credit analysis & preparation of progress reports
    • Review and follow up on daily basis team’s updates of daily KPIs like cash tracker, productivity, disputed accounts, escalations log, and take needful action
    • Drive collection & strategy planning of debt control, particularly mitigate roll over of debt past the 90-day category
    • Enforce the credit policy and assure adherence to accepted standards
    • Proactively drive improvements in business processes and procedures, e.g. invoicing, follow up, and query/dispute management
    • Spearhead escalations and ensure prompt stop service on non paying accounts
    • Actively manage and attain reduction of company bad debt provision as per KPIs
    • Improve company cash cycle and enhance cash conversion as per KPIs
    • Preparation of weekly rollover and month end MMA reports.
    • Take a leadership role in the Top debtors and suspension review meetings.
    • Ensure basic Governance processes are in place across the EA Region with respect to the 26 key controls impacting the Credit Control Department
    • Ensure that all the necessary controls are implemented and embedded to minimize fraud risk related to debt collections and receipt allocations across East Africa
    • Support the year-end audit process in debtors related matters, ensuring that we complete the audit within budget for this area and Group deadlines
    • Support the Team Leaders to ensure that On guard utilization in country is fully embedded, CC' activity is monitored effectively and command center reporting is used
    • Provide Induction training to all new Sales Consultants and annual refresher training to the Credit Control Department.
    • Manage disputes through dispute resolution meetings with the Branch Managers and analysis of the underlying dispute root causes
    • Use insights from debtors collection & ledger analysis to identify collection trends, prepare root cause analysis and support FD to drive plans to mitigate impact on OCF
    • Maintain, and retain principal information ownership and access to the Company debtors database/portfolio and ensure proper safeguards are in place in line with information confidentiality IT policies
    • Allocate and reallocate on need basis the debtors portfolio to respective Credit Controllers to improve and address collections challenges
    • Support in the management of cash accounts to ensure prompt collections
    • Actively motivate the Credit Control Team and provide effective guidance and leadership
    • Proactively plan for and execute thorough and structured performance review of each Credit
    • Controller’s performance on monthly basis with support of the Team Leaders
    • Proactively enlist the concerted support of the teams from other departments, especially service operations in driving debt collection activity in their own capacity
    • Review Top Debtors allocated to Branch Managers, offering requisite support and follow through to ensure proactive action to collect is taken
    • Actively follow up and review collection progress by the external debt collectors, including the lawyers, noting to monitor their active involvement

    Requirements

    •  Bachelor's Degree
    •  Diploma in Credit Management is an added Advantage
    •  At least 5 years experience in a busy Credit Control department , two years of which should have
    • been in a supervisory or management level.
